Installation

Installation of our systems are quick and easy. In fact, it does not necessarily require a specialist fitter to carry out the installation.

AcoustiCloud acoustic ceiling panels are simply suspended by steel cables from the soffit by means of special spiral hooks which are fitted into the reverse of the panel by means of clockwise rotation. Height level adjustment can be carried out by manipulating the length of each cable to suit when it is inserted into the eyelet hook.

AcoustiCloud acoustic ceiling panels can be set at an angle if required to increase design and aesthetic properties.

The spiral hooks should be placed approximately 200mm in from the edge of the AcoustiCloud Ceiling Panel. For angled installations, we recommend the largest panels to be no more than 600mm x 600mm.

Key Facts

Technical Specifications

  • Length: 600mm, 1200mm, 1800mm, 2400mm
  • Width: 300mm, 600mm, 900mm, 1200mm
  • Depth: 25mm & 40mm
  • Panel Size: Custom shapes & sizes available (square, rectangle, circle, clouds, ellipse , oblong, triangle, hexagon, diamond, teardrop)
  • Colours: Multiple Colours & Shades, Bespoke Printing available
  • Weight: 3kg/m2 (25mm), 4kg/m2 (40mm)
  • Core Fire Rating: Class O BS476: Part 6
  • Fabric Fire Rating: Class 1 to BS476: Part 7
  • Performance: Class A & Class 0 Sound Absorption.
  • Installation
    Simple and easy application with bespoke fixings (spiral hooks, steel cables, height adjusted clips (ceiling), impaling clips (walls))
